How safe is Terramycin for cats?

Terramycin is typically safe and serious side effects should not be expected, but some stinging can occur. Contact your veterinarian immediately if your cat has swelling of the face, itching, or appears to have difficulty breathing—these may be signs of an allergic reaction to Terramycin.

How tetracycline inhibits protein synthesis?

The tetracyclines, which were discovered in the 1940s, are a family of antibiotics that inhibit protein synthesis by preventing the attachment of aminoacyl-tRNA to the ribosomal acceptor (A) site.

What are tetracycline antibiotics used to treat?

Tetracycline is used to treat infections caused by bacteria including pneumonia and other respiratory tract infections; ; certain infections of skin, eye, lymphatic, intestinal, genital and urinary systems; and certain other infections that are spread by ticks, lice, mites, and infected animals.

What’s the difference between viralys and terramycin for cats?

Viralys is not a medication, it is an L-Lysine supplement to help with the herpes virus, which is usually the cause for cats URIs. Clavamox is probably for the UTI, or if he has a secondary infection from the URI. Terramycin is for the eye infection.

What happens to your eyes when you take Terramycin?

Terramycin normally causes them to squint. I think it burns a little bit and yes it makes them look greasy around the eye. You can use a cotton ball with warm water to get the excess off their coat, but wait at least 5 minutes. It takes about that long for the eye to absorb the medication.

What does Terramycin do for a bacterial infection?

Terramycin is an antibiotic. Antibiotics are for treating bacterial infections. Terramycin has a spectrum that covers SOME bacterial infections. Does nothing for viruses, and does nothing for many common bacteria that cause disease.
